A river system is a network of rivers and streams that drain an area of land, known as a watershed or drainage basin. The importance of a river system cannot be overstated, as it plays a crucial role in the ecosystem, economy, and culture of the regions it traverses. In this essay, I will explore the various aspects of a river system, including its formation, significance, and the challenges it faces in the modern world.The formation of a river system begins with precipitation, which falls as rain or snow. This water collects in various forms, such as lakes, ponds, and soil moisture, before eventually flowing into streams and rivers. As these bodies of water converge, they form a larger network, creating a comprehensive river system. The flow of water through this system is influenced by gravity, topography, and geological structures. Over time, erosion and sediment deposition shape the landscape, leading to the development of valleys and floodplains.One of the primary functions of a river system is to transport water from higher elevations to lower ones, facilitating the movement of nutrients and sediments. This process is vital for maintaining the health of ecosystems, as it supports diverse habitats for plants and animals. Many species rely on river systems for their survival, using them as sources of food, shelter, and breeding grounds. Additionally, river systems contribute to the overall biodiversity of an area, as they connect different ecosystems and allow for the exchange of genetic material among species.Economically, river systems serve as critical resources for communities. They provide water for drinking, agriculture, and industry, making them essential for human survival and economic development. Many cities are built along river systems, as they offer transportation routes for trade and commerce. Historically, civilizations have flourished near river systems, relying on them for irrigation and food production. The fertile lands surrounding rivers often support agriculture, leading to prosperous communities.However, river systems face numerous challenges today. Urbanization, pollution, and climate change are significant threats to their health and sustainability. As cities expand, natural landscapes are altered, leading to increased runoff and sedimentation in rivers. This can disrupt the delicate balance of aquatic ecosystems and reduce water quality. Pollution from industrial and agricultural activities further exacerbates these issues, contaminating water sources and harming wildlife.Climate change also poses a serious risk to river systems, affecting precipitation patterns and increasing the frequency of extreme weather events. Droughts can lead to reduced water flow, while heavy rainfall can cause flooding, both of which have detrimental effects on the health of river systems. These changes can disrupt the habitats of countless species and threaten the livelihoods of communities that depend on these water sources.In conclusion, a river system is an intricate network that serves multiple ecological, economic, and cultural functions. Understanding the significance of river systems is essential for their conservation and management. As we face increasing environmental challenges, it is crucial to protect these vital resources for future generations. By promoting sustainable practices and raising awareness about the importance of river systems, we can help ensure their health and resilience in the face of adversity.
